  • Characteristics of Ferrite-Rich Portland Cement

    Ferrite-rich Portland cement can be produced by lowering the burning temperature by 100°C (i.e. at 1 350°C) which can reduce the energy consumption by 5 in comparison with ordinary Portland cement (OPC) clinker.

  • Cement Physical Properties and Types of Cement

    When referring to Portland cement "soundness" refers to the ability of a hardened cement paste to retain its volume after setting without delayed expansion. This expansion is caused by excessive amounts of free lime (CaO) or magnesia (MgO). Most Portland cement

  • ConcreteProperties

    Typical properties of normal strength Portland cement concrete Densityρ kg/m3 (140150 lb/ft3) Compressive strength 2040 MPa ( psi) Flexural strength 35 MPa (400700 psi) Tensile strengthσ 25 MPa (300700 psi) Modulus of elasticityE 1441 GPa (26 x 106 psi)

  • Properties of Cement- Physical ChemicalCivil Engineering

    Portland cement has a specific gravity of 3.15 but other types of cement (for example portland-blast-furnace-slag and portland-pozzolan cement) may have specific gravities of about 2.90. Standard Test AASHTO T 133 and ASTM C 188 Density of Hydraulic Cement. Chemical Properties of Cement

  • 9 Types of Portland Cement and their ApplicationsHome

    Also called Ordinary Portland Cement (OPC) Type I is a general-purpose cement which is adequate for most uses except those which require the special properties of other types. It has an adequate strength and a low heat of hydration. Type I cement is not suitable for uses where the concrete can face chemical attacks or excessive temperature
